African rotavirus surveillance network: a brief overview
Jason M Mwenda1, Jacqueline E Tate, Umesh D Parashar
1From the *World Health Organization, Regional Office for Africa, Brazzaville, Republic of Congo; †National Center for Immunization and Respiratory Diseases, CDC, Atlanta, GA; and ‡World Health Organization, Geneva, Switzerland.
Reliable rotavirus disease burden data is crucial for African countries to inform decisions on introducing new rotavirus vaccines. Sentinel surveillance platforms are generating country-specific evidence for policy-making in diarrhea control.

Background:
- Rotavirus gastroenteritis is a major cause of childhood diarrhea globally.
- New rotavirus vaccines are becoming available, necessitating data on disease burden for informed introduction.
- Effective diarrhea control strategies require accurate, country-specific epidemiological data.
Purpose of the Study:
- To establish and utilize sentinel surveillance systems across African nations.
- To generate reliable data on the burden of rotavirus diarrhea in children under 5 years.
- To support evidence-based decision-making for rotavirus vaccine introduction and national immunization programs.
Main Methods:
- Implementing standardized guidelines for rotavirus diarrhea surveillance.
- Focusing surveillance on children under 5 years of age.
- Utilizing World Health Organization supported platforms since 2006.
Main Results:
- African countries are generating high-quality, country-specific data on rotavirus gastroenteritis burden.
- Surveillance data provides evidence for the impact of rotavirus disease.
- The generated data is actively used by policymakers.
Conclusions:
- Sentinel surveillance is effective in documenting rotavirus disease burden in Africa.
- Data generated informs policy decisions on rotavirus vaccine introduction.
- This evidence supports the integration of rotavirus vaccines into national immunization programs for diarrhea control.
